Masulgondi - Devkar, Bemetara

Masulgondi is a village situated in the Devkar tehsil of Bemetara district, Chhattisgarh. It is located approximately 15 km from Saja and around 68 km from Durg. Masulgondi village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Masulgondi is 442158. The village covers a total geographical area of 414.15 hectares and falls under the 491993 pincode. Parpodhi is the nearest town, located about 10 km away.

Masulgondi village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Bemetara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Durg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Masulgondi

As per Census 2011, Masulgondi village has a total population of 956 people, consisting of 470 males and 486 females. The village has 183 households and a sex ratio of 1,034 females per 1,000 males. There are 145 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 531 literate and 425 illiterate residents. Additionally, 17 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 94 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Masulgondi

Masulgondi is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Parpodhi to Masulgondi is about 10 km, with a usual travel time of around 15-30 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Durg to Masulgondi is about 68 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.9 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
